What Is Depression?

Depression is a common disorder that can severely impact an individual's mood, and there are various forms of depression such as: unipolar, bipolar, major, dysthymia and seasonal affective disorder. The primary causes of depression are environmental stress and genetics. Substance abuse, physical and psychological abuse are just a few examples of environmental stress. Depression is also commonly passed down through your family from the preceding generations. Depression can be successfully treated through therapy and medication.
